Sam Altman: Meta spent 100 million USD to attract OpenAI talent but failed.
OpenAI CEO Sam Altman stated that Meta has offered a contract signing bonus of up to 100 million USD to recruit talent from OpenAI, but no one has accepted. Altman described Meta's approach as "crazy" and believes that this company is aggressively hunting talent because OpenAI plays a central role in the global AI race.
Mark Zuckerberg is directly leading the recruitment campaign for Meta's new "superintelligence" division, competing with OpenAI, Anthropic, and Google DeepMind. Meta recently invested 14.3 billion USD in Scale AI and is hiring many experts from major AI centers, such as Jack Rae from Google DeepMind.
Altman is confident that OpenAI can hold onto its team thanks to a mission-driven culture that is not influenced by money. He emphasized that true innovation comes from meaningful goals, not just from the sky-high salaries that Meta is proposing.
